Simple Account Protection Tips
Users should create secure passwords to help reduce unauthorized access risks. Using identical login credentials on multiple websites is generally not recommended. Complex passwords are generally harder for attackers to guess or compromise.
Two-factor authentication adds another layer of account protection for users. This adds an extra layer of protection and helps prevent unauthorized access to personal accounts.
Protecting Your Identity In Live Conversations
During online video chats, it is important to avoid sharing sensitive information such as:
• Home addresses
• Private contact numbers
• Financial account details
• Personal identification numbers
• Professional contact information
• Direct social networking accounts
Even casual conversations can sometimes reveal private information unintentionally. Visible backgrounds and nearby objects may sometimes expose private information.

Staying Alert While Using Live Streaming Services
Internet scams and fake accounts remain common concerns across digital communities. Downloading unverified files may increase cybersecurity risks.
Warning signs may include:
• Unexpected financial requests
• Moving communication away from trusted platforms
• Fake verification messages
• Attempts to collect personal content
Careful online behavior may help users avoid many common internet risks.
